A serious VR demo developed for the Meta Quest 2.
Work as a farmer on a martian colony, providing food and oxygen to your fellow colonists while maintaining balance of resources like water and electricity.
This was the final project of the AR/VR add-on course I attended at the Inland Norway university of applied science.
I was the programmer and co-game designer during this project, as well as doing most of the research to scientifically back the project. I also took care of most of the optimization to achieve our target performance.
Other team member: Eivind Gundersrud
Developed in Unity at the Inland Norway university of applied science, 2024

A game engine made from the ground up in C++ using OpenGL, Bullet and FMod. The engine could simulate physics, such as a ball ramming through a group of small cubes, and also had a "black hole" tool, which would suck up all physics objects around it and hold them until released.
I was responsible for adding sound functionality and worked on the component systems in the engine.
Developed at the Norway Inland university of applied science 2022/23
Other team members: Hans Ola Hoftun and Fabian Aude Steen
A gamefication project, with the core idea of creating a game that would teach its players about security procedures and potential dangers on board a cargo ship. The player would embark on a voyage, during which a series of problems could occur on board the ship. When a problem occured, they had to make the crew go and fix the issue safely by following procedure. Some problems could be prevented entirely by performing routine tasks, which awarded them more points.
We also spoke with the Norwegian Maritime Authority about the project, and we got a lot of help from them during the design phase.
Prototype developed in Unreal 4.27 at the Inland Norway university of applied science, 2022
Other team members: Hans Ola Hoftun, Regine Tvedt Heien, Ruben Olsrud, Sebastian Miranda
